Transaction e825583bc472878edfd20b5b380fa782aac2443a723061d3816e85be90aee593
1 Input
1 Output
-
e825583bc472878edfd20b5b380fa782aac2443a723061d3816e85be90aee593:0
- value
- 76326787
- script pubkey
- OP_0 OP_PUSHBYTES_20 b5fa42fb8eb3183fa0928710fd47fdff8168c5e3
- address
- bc1qkhay97uwkvvrlgyjsug063lal7qk330rcgelsv